hey guys.....wsrf asked me to put this info for you guys.

This is the Formula Maruti ROOKIE series

All the races will be held in Chennai only.
The dates are
1.April 15
2.April 16
3.April 29
4.April 30
5.June 3
6.June 4

Total 6 rounds.
The schedule is as follows : for each round two 30 minutes
practice and two races.

Prize money 10000,7000 and 5000 for each races.

Entry fee of Rs.500 to be paid to the club.

For the car charges are 10000 per round.This includes car
rental,fuel,mechanic charges and car maintanance.If any damages happen that need to be paid separetly.

You have to get a racing licence also for participating in the races.
You can check with MAI for that

If you need any clarification please mail us info@wallacesports.com
